The property at 2144 Delano Street in Pensacola, FL is a 3,680-square-foot industrial warehouse situated on a 0.17-acre lot. Zoned for heavy commercial and light industrial use (HC/LI), it offers a versatile space ideal for logistics, distribution, or light manufacturing operations. Built in 1963, the structure includes a large grade-level roll-up door with 13-foot interior clearance, making it accessible for deliveries and equipment. Inside, there is approximately 800 square feet of climate-controlled workshop space with its own HVAC system, along with an office area that includes a bathroom and shower.
Positioned just off a busy intersection near Pace Boulevard and Fairfield Avenue, the property enjoys excellent visibility and convenient access to major transportation routes, including the Port of Pensacola and the airport. Originally used as a machine shop, the building features an updated three-phase power panel suitable for industrial equipment. While the overall structure is functional, some improvements are needed, including roof replacement and exterior repainting.
